Answer:
8x^3-46x^2-5x+18
Step-by-step explanation:
The volume of a rectangular prism is L*W*H where
L=length
W=width
H=height.
So we want to probably find the standard form of this multiplication because writing (4x+3)(x-6)(2x-1) is too easy.
Let's multiply (4x+3) and (x-6), then take that result and multiply it to (2x-1).
(4x+3)(x-6)
I'm going to use FOIL here.
First: 4x(x)=4x^2
Outer: 4x(-6)=-24x
Inner: 3(x)=3x
Last: 3(-6)=-18
---------------------------Add.
4x^2-21x-18
So we now have to multiply (4x^2-21x-18) and (2x-1).
We will not be able to use FOIL here because we are not doing a binomial times a binomial.
We can still use distributive property though.
(4x^2-21x-18)(2x-1)
=
4x^2(2x-1)-21x(2x-1)-18(2x-1)
=
8x^3-4x^2-42x^2+21x-36x+18
Now the like terms are actually already paired up we just need to combine them:
8x^3-46x^2-5x+18
<u>A. 587 * 92</u>
We are rounding these factors to the nearest ten, so 587 becomes 590 and 92 becomes 90.
Now multiply 590 and 90.
590 * 90 = 53,100; 59 * 9 = 531, and then add on the two zeroes.
The following answer of 54,004 is reasonable because it is close to our estimate of 53,100.
<u>B. 117 * 19</u>
Rounding these numbers to the nearest ten, you make 117 become 120 and 19 become 20.
Multiply 120 and 20.
120 * 20 = 2,400; I multiplied 12 and 2 to get 24, then added on the two zeroes.
The following answer of 222.3 is not reasonable because it is way off from 2,400. They are about 1,200 apart.
